Edgewater Technical Associates is seeking qualified candidates for a Materials & Test Equipment (M&TE) Specialist opportunity to support the Savannah River Site.

The M&TE Specialist / Technician will support the project Quality organization by maintaining control of Measuring & Test Equipment (M&TE) used for construction inspection and testing. This position ensures equipment is properly identified, calibrated, traceable, documented, and suitable for use in accordance with project quality requirements.

Duties:
  • Maintain the project M&TE inventory, database, calibration records, and equipment status.
  • Track calibration due dates and coordinate calibration, repair, replacement, and return of equipment.
  • Review calibration certificates for accuracy, acceptance, and traceability to applicable standards.
  • Issue and receive M&TE and verify equipment is properly identified, labeled, and within calibration prior to use.
  • Perform field inventories and verify M&TE is properly stored, protected, controlled, and used.
  • Identify and remove expired, damaged, out-of-calibration, or otherwise unacceptable equipment from service.
  • Support evaluation and documentation of out-of-tolerance or out-of-calibration conditions.
  • Coordinate with QC Inspectors, Quality Engineering, Construction, Field Engineering, Materials, subcontractors, and calibration vendors.
  • Review subcontractor M&TE and calibration documentation when equipment is used for acceptance inspections or testing.
  • Maintain complete M&TE records for audits, assessments, quality records, and project turnover.
  • Support audits and surveillances of M&TE and calibration activities.
Skills/Experience:
  • Experience with M&TE, metrology, calibration, measuring equipment, or inspection/test equipment control in construction, nuclear, DOE, power generation, manufacturing, or another regulated industrial environment.
  • Knowledge of calibration practices, equipment identification and control, calibration intervals, and measurement traceability.
  • Experience reviewing calibration certificates and maintaining M&TE/calibration records.
  • Ability to read and follow technical procedures, specifications, and manufacturer requirements.
  • Strong organizational, documentation, and computer/database skills.
  • Experience may include torque wrenches, pressure gauges, multimeters, megohmmeters, temperature instruments, calipers, micrometers, levels, welding gauges, coating thickness gauges, load cells, and other measuring or test equipment used for civil, mechanical, electrical, welding, and construction Quality activities.
Preferred Qualifications:
  • Experience with nuclear, DOE, NQA-1, 10 CFR 50 Appendix B, or other regulated Quality programs.
  • Familiarity with NIST traceability, ISO/IEC 17025, ANSI/NCSL Z540, or similar calibration requirements.
